THE FINALS offers four distinct game modes: Tournament (Cashout), Quick Cash, Bank It, and Power Shift, each offering a unique gameplay experience.

In Tournament (Cashout), players can choose between Ranked and Unranked modes. While the gameplay is the same, Ranked mode introduces a ranking system where wins and losses impact the player's rank. Unranked mode, on the other hand, is perfect for those looking for a more relaxed gaming experience without the pressure of ranking.

In Quick Cash mode, the intensity ramps up as one of the four squads from Cashout is removed, leaving three teams to compete. Players will experience faster respawns and extractions compared to Cashout, creating a quicker-paced gameplay. While still offering a similar experience to Unranked Tournament, Quick Cash is slightly more relaxed. Additionally, Quick Cash features only one vault, streamlining the gameplay for faster action.

In Bank It mode, players compete to collect as many coins as possible within a set time frame. The objective is for one of the four teams to reach the maximum coin count to secure victory. Alternatively, if no team reaches the maximum, the winner is determined by the team with the most coins when time expires.

Power Shift mode pits two teams of five against each other on a moving platform. It's essentially a tug-of-war scenario where one team strives to pull the platform to their side by standing on it, while the opposing team aims to reclaim control. Victory goes to the team that successfully guides the platform to its destination or progresses the farthest by the end of the time limit.

THE FINALS is accessible on PC, PlayStation 5, and Xbox Series X/S platforms. It adopts a free-to-play model, meaning you can jump in without any upfront costs. However, you do have the option to purchase Multibucks, the in-game currency used for acquiring battle passes and cosmetic items.
